AMS8921 Guilloche enamel and diamond pendant by Henry Blank & Co. circa 1910
€4,950.00Paperclip link chain with tapered barrel beads and a central sautoir pendant with diamonds and natural pearls. Beads are elongated and feature opaque white enamel and blue guilloche enamel stripes. Transparent and glossed over an engraved radial pattern. Makers mark for Henry Blank & Co.
Founded as N.E Whiteside in 1890, Henry Blank joined in 1903 becoming Whiteside & Blank and then Henry Blank & Co. Makers mark of a C with an arrow through it was used from the beginning. Henry Blank had travelled to Europe to study and conduct business with watch movement manufacturers, and returned to America on board the Titanic, surviving the sinking in 1912 -
AVT8898 Exceptional quality cameo/pendant, circa 1870
A hard stone cameo of exceptional quality, depicting a Bacchante (female follower of the Roman god of wine, Bacchus – also known as a Maenad in Greek mythology, a follower of Dionysus the Greek god of wine)shown carrying a Thyrsus – a staff tipped with a pine cone or ivy – dancing in the abandonment of ecstatic frenzy. Exceptionally fine rope motif in a high carat gold mount with a heavier rope gold mount terminating in ram’s heads. The brooch fitting can be unscrewed to be worn on a chain. Original fitted case by Shepheard & Reed, Regent Street
